Форум русскоязычного сообщества Ubuntu


Автор Тема: Прооблема pptpd  (Прочитано 2008 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н lista

  • Автор темы
  • Новичок
  • *
  • Сообщений: 2
    • Просмотр профиля
Прооблема pptpd
« : 24 Февраль 2008, 13:51:00 »
Есть такая конфигурация pptpd
==============   pptpd.conf  ======================
option /etc/ppp/pptpd-options

#debug

# stimeout 10

#noipparam

logwtmp

#bcrelay eth1

localip 192.168.3.1
remoteip 192.168.3.234-238,192.168.3.250
============================================================

==================  /etc/ppp/pptpd-options  ===== ===================

name pptp

# domain mydomain.net

auth


# Require the peer to authenticate itself using PAP.
#+pap

# Don't agree to authenticate using PAP.
-pap

# Require the peer to authenticate itself using CHAP [Cryptographic
# Handshake Authentication Protocol] authentication.
+chap

# Don't agree to authenticate using CHAP.
#-chap

debug

proxyarp

#192.168.3.100:192.168.3.250
====================  =======================

=================  /etc/ppp/chap-secrets ============
sem32 pptp sem32 192.168.3.250
============================


Запускаем на Винде VPN
Настройка протокола IP для Windows

ipconfig

Подключение по локальной сети - Ethernet адаптер:

        Состояние сети  . . . . . . . . . : сеть отключена

Беспроводное сетевое соединение 2 - Ethernet адаптер:

        DNS-суффикс этого подключения . . : Home
        IP-адрес  . . . . . . . . . . . . : 192.168.0.102
        Маска подсети . . . . . . . . . . : 255.255.255.0
        Основной шлюз . . . . . . . . . . : 192.168.0.1

Anna - PPP адаптер:

        DNS-суффикс этого подключения . . :
        IP-адрес  . . . . . . . . . . . . : 192.168.3.250
        Маска подсети . . . . . . . . . . : 255.255.255.255
        Основной шлюз . . . . . . . . . . :



На линухе вот такое дал ifconfig

ppp0      Link encap:Point-to-Point Protocol
          inet addr:192.168.0.1  P-t-P:192.168.3.250  Mask:255.255.255.255
          UP POINTOPOINT RUNNING NOARP MULTICAST  MTU:1400  Metric:1
          RX packets:42 errors:0 dropped:0 overruns:0 frame:0
          TX packets:16 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:10
          RX bytes:5926 (5.7 KiB)  TX bytes:479 (479.0 b)


От куда взялся inet addr:192.168.0.1 (заказывал же localip 192.168.3.1)?
Вообще так и должно быть?

Оффлайн alkov

  • Новичок
  • *
  • Сообщений: 4
    • Просмотр профиля
Re: Прооблема pptpd
« Ответ #1 : 24 Февраль 2008, 22:06:43 »
Сдается мне, здесь после настройки необходимо рестартонуть pptpd

Оффлайн lista

  • Автор темы
  • Новичок
  • *
  • Сообщений: 2
    • Просмотр профиля
Re: Прооблема pptpd
« Ответ #2 : 25 Февраль 2008, 01:19:09 »
Благодарю!
Помог полный - reboot

Тема закрыта

Оффлайн Nesmit

  • Старожил
  • *
  • Сообщений: 1296
    • Просмотр профиля
Re: Прооблема pptpd
« Ответ #3 : 01 Апрель 2008, 16:13:16 »
а зачем нужен полный ребут? у меня вот то же настройки не применяются, а ребутить низя :'(

Оффлайн Nesmit

  • Старожил
  • *
  • Сообщений: 1296
    • Просмотр профиля
Re: Прооблема pptpd
« Ответ #4 : 01 Апрель 2008, 17:14:01 »
В логах такая ошибка
Цитировать
Apr  1 16:06:24 malino pptpd[5136]: CTRL: Client 192.168.2.21 control connection started
Apr  1 16:06:24 malino pptpd[5136]: CTRL: Starting call (launching pppd, opening GRE)
Apr  1 16:06:24 malino pptpd[5136]: GRE: Bad checksum from pppd.
Apr  1 16:06:24 malino pptpd[5136]: CTRL: Ignored a SET LINK INFO packet with real ACCMs!
Apr  1 16:06:24 malino pptpd[5136]: CTRL: Reaping child PPP[5137]
Apr  1 16:06:24 malino pptpd[5136]: CTRL: Client 192.168.2.21 control connection finished
Цитировать
Apr  1 17:12:35 malino pppd[5980]: Plugin /usr/lib/pppd/2.4.4/radius.so loaded.
Apr  1 17:12:35 malino pppd[5980]: RADIUS plugin initialized.
Apr  1 17:12:35 malino pppd[5980]: Plugin /usr/lib/pppd/2.4.4/radattr.so loaded.
Apr  1 17:12:35 malino pppd[5980]: RADATTR plugin initialized.
Apr  1 17:12:35 malino pppd[5980]: pppd options in effect:
Apr  1 17:12:35 malino pppd[5980]: debug^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: dump^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: plugin /usr/lib/pppd/2.4.4/radius.so^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: plugin /usr/lib/pppd/2.4.4/radattr.so^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: +mschap^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: -pap^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: name pptpd^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: 115200^I^I# (from command line)
Apr  1 17:12:35 malino pppd[5980]: lock^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: crtscts^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: local^I^I# (from command line)
Apr  1 17:12:35 malino pppd[5980]: asyncmap 0^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: silent^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: lcp-echo-failure 4^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: lcp-echo-interval 30^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: hide-password^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: ipparam 192.168.2.21^I^I# (from command line)
Apr  1 17:12:35 malino pppd[5980]: ms-dns xxx # [don't know how to print value]^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: proxyarp^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: 192.168.100.1:192.168.100.2^I^I# (from command line)
Apr  1 17:12:35 malino pppd[5980]: nobsdcomp^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: nodeflate^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: nomppe^I^I# (from /etc/ppp/options.pptpd)
Apr  1 17:12:35 malino pppd[5980]: noipx^I^I# (from /etc/ppp/options)
Apr  1 17:12:35 malino pppd[5980]: pppd 2.4.4 started by root, uid 0
Apr  1 17:12:35 malino pppd[5980]: Using interface ppp0
Apr  1 17:12:35 malino pppd[5980]: Connect: ppp0 <--> /dev/pts/12
Apr  1 17:12:37 malino pppd[5980]: Peer test failed CHAP authentication
Apr  1 17:12:37 malino pppd[5980]: Connection terminated.
Apr  1 17:12:37 malino pppd[5980]: Exit
До "freeradius -X" этот pppd даже не достукивается, что бы спросить пароль.
Причем оговорюсь, 3 машины с абсолютно одинаковыми конфигами, на 2х работает, на 3й никак :(

« Последнее редактирование: 01 Апрель 2008, 17:19:57 от Nesmit »

Оффлайн Nesmit

  • Старожил
  • *
  • Сообщений: 1296
    • Просмотр профиля
Re: Прооблема pptpd
« Ответ #5 : 02 Апрель 2008, 11:11:46 »
Еще раза 3 перепроверил все конфиги pptpd+radiusclient, все так же и работает. :'(
Цитировать
Apr  1 17:12:35 malino pppd[5980]: Connect: ppp0 <--> /dev/pts/12
Мне не нравится эта строчка :(
Я так понимаю, pptpd не может соединиться с radiusclient ?


Оффлайн Nesmit

  • Старожил
  • *
  • Сообщений: 1296
    • Просмотр профиля
Re: Прооблема pptpd
« Ответ #6 : 15 Апрель 2008, 14:57:05 »
Все решилось  :D
оказалось что давно поменял имя компа на другое отличное от "malino" вернул, все запахало. .)

 

Страница сгенерирована за 0.23 секунд. Запросов: 22.